Help young children develop critical thinking skills with open-ended problems, for which there is no one correct answer.
Working in small groups, children use readily available manipulatives to explore various solutions and describe their answers through writing and drawing. Each activity page can be reused multiple times, using larger numbers as children become more adept at working with small numbers. A fun and engaging way to promote mathematical thinking!

Rosenburg began teaching first grade in Fresno, California, in 1989. She has a master's degree in education counseling as well as a cross-cultural language and academic certificate. From 1994 through 1997, Mary was a mentor teacher, working with first-year teachers and experienced teachers new to first grade. She has also been a master teacher for students in the credential program at California State University, Fresno.
